There is a place where deep-rooted tensions and skeletons in the closet are thickly veiled by generations-learned etiquette and hidden agendas. A place where the Constitution and the Bible are required reading, but behind every sun-worn smile there's a dark secret. A place that can be just as shadowy as the muddy waters that run through it, especially when it comes to planning, committing, and covering up a crime. While highlighting how law enforcement in the South is a personal business, not a scientific one, Southern Gothic explores the duplicitous characters, unique settings, and boundless mystery of murder in the American South.
